Does Betaine Actually Improve Strength and Power? What the RCTs Show

The honest answer

Some signal, mostly on secondary endpoints, never on 1RM strength itself. Seven sports-performance RCTs test betaine at ~2.5g/day. Several find real improvements in upper-body power, endurance reps, or body composition. But every single trial that measured 1-rep-max strength directly (Cholewa 2013, Cholewa 2018) found NO advantage for betaine over placebo — the primary strength outcome was null in both. One trial (Cholewa 2018) discloses a DuPont funding tie; disclosed here every time it's cited.

The seven trials, read together

Betaine sports-performance RCTs in this evidence base
StudyDesignResult
Lee 2010
PMID 20642826
Crossover, n=12 trained men, 14-day arms Bench throw power & isometric bench press force up; jump squat power & rep performance no difference. Benefits "more apparent in smaller upper-body muscle groups."
Armstrong 2008
PMID 18438230
Crossover, n=10 runners, hot-weather run+sprint Sprint duration +16-21% but a nonsignificant trend; authors' own conclusion did NOT "definitively support" betaine for sprint performance.
Cholewa 2013
PMID 23967897
RCT, n=23 strength-trained men, 6wk Arm cross-sectional area, body fat%, lean mass improved; NO difference in bench press or back squat 1RM — the primary strength outcome was null.
Cholewa 2018
PMID 30064450 DuPont-funded
RCT, n=23 untrained collegiate women, 8wk Body fat% and fat mass drop improved; squat 1RM improved ~equally in both groups — no strength advantage. One author employed by DuPont Nutrition & Health, a betaine supplier.
Hoffman 2009
PMID 19250531
RCT, n=24 men, 15 days Squat endurance (reps to exhaustion) improved at day 7 only; bench press endurance and every power/anaerobic measure (vertical jump, bench throw, Wingate) showed no difference.
Nobari 2021
PMID 33663545
RCT, n=29 youth soccer players, 14wk, 2g/day Testosterone:cortisol ratio increased; growth hormone, IGF-1, lean mass, body fat showed no significant interaction — an endocrine-marker shift, not a performance outcome.
Cholewa 2014
PMID 24760587 investigator review
Narrative review, not primary data Concludes "positive effects... despite some conflicting results," while acknowledging mechanisms and long-term effects "remain to be elucidated." Author (Cholewa) ran two of the primary positive-leaning trials himself.

Every trial that directly measured 1-rep-max strength (Cholewa 2013, Cholewa 2018) found no betaine advantage. Where positive results appear, they're on power, endurance-rep, or body-composition measures — real, but not the strength claim marketing often implies.

Why the signal clusters on secondary endpoints, not strength

Reading these seven trials together, a consistent pattern emerges: betaine's more plausible mechanism at ~2.5g/day is as an osmolyte that may support cell hydration and power output in acute efforts, or a modest influence on body composition over weeks of training — not a direct strength-building agent the way creatine's phosphocreatine-resynthesis mechanism is. Lee 2010's power gains were concentrated in "smaller upper-body muscle groups," a narrower finding than a general strength claim. Hoffman 2009's one positive measure (squat endurance) appeared only at a single timepoint (day 7) and not at day 14, undercutting a durable-effect story. And in both trials that directly tested the outcome people actually care about — how much weight can you lift for one rep — betaine matched placebo, not beat it.

The disclosed conflicts, named plainly

Cholewa et al. 2018 discloses that one study author was employed by DuPont Nutrition & Health, a betaine ingredient supplier — a real conflict of interest worth naming every time this trial is cited, including here. Separately, Cholewa 2014, the one narrative review synthesizing this literature, was authored by the same researcher (Cholewa) who ran two of the primary positive-leaning trials in this pack (2013, 2018). That doesn't make the review wrong, but it means it should be read as an investigator's own synthesis and perspective on his own body of work, not as an independent, disinterested meta-analysis — a distinction worth keeping in mind when you see this review cited as if it settled the question.

The one-line takeaway At ~2.5g/day, betaine shows some real signal on power, endurance reps, and body composition across small trials — but zero trials that measured 1-rep-max strength found an advantage over placebo. Honest verdict: some signal, mostly on secondary endpoints, never on 1RM strength itself. Frequently asked questions

Does betaine build strength?

No trial found a 1RM advantage. Cholewa 2013 and 2018 both measured it directly and found no difference vs. placebo.

What did the positive trials actually find?

Upper-body power (Lee 2010), body composition (Cholewa 2013/2018), squat endurance at one timepoint (Hoffman 2009) — secondary endpoints, not strength.

Is there a conflict of interest?

Yes — Cholewa 2018 discloses a DuPont Nutrition & Health-employed author. Cholewa 2014's review was written by an author of two of the primary trials.

Should I take betaine for performance?

Possible small power/body-composition benefit at ~2.5g/day — not a strength-building supplement in the way creatine is.
